The Art of Compiler Design: Bridging Theory and Practice Compilers are the "unsung heroes" of computer science, transforming human-readable high-level code into the binary reality executed by hardware. While many developers treat them as black boxes, understanding their design reveals a fascinating intersection of mathematical precision and engineering pragmatism.
